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Silver City

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Silver City, Nevada.

What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Silver City, Nevada?

In Silver City, Nevada,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,000, depending on the level of care, amenities, and specific facility. This is generally in line with Nevada state averages, though costs can vary based on room type and additional services required.

Are there any assisted living facilities located directly in Silver City, NV?

Silver City is a small, unincorporated community with limited senior care facilities directly within its boundaries. Residents often look to nearby areas such as Carson City or Dayton for assisted living options, which are within a short driving distance and offer a range of licensed facilities.

What types of services do assisted living facilities near Silver City, NV typically provide?

Assisted living facilities in the Silver City area and nearby communities generally offer services such as medication management, personal care assistance, meal preparation, housekeeping, and social activities. Many also provide specialized care for conditions like dementia, and they often coordinate with local healthcare providers in Lyon County or Carson City.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in Nevada, and what should I look for in a facility near Silver City?

Assisted living facilities in Nevada are licensed and regulated by the Nevada Division of Public and Behavioral Health (DPBH). When evaluating a facility near Silver City, ensure it has a valid state license, check for any past violations via the DPBH website, and look for features like staff training, safety measures, and resident satisfaction. Local facilities should also comply with Nevada's staffing and care standards.

What local resources are available in Silver City, NV to help families choose an assisted living facility?

Families in Silver City can contact the Nevada Aging and Disability Services Division (ADSD) for information and referrals to assisted living options. Additionally, local senior centers in nearby Carson City or Lyon County, as well as area support groups, can provide guidance and resources to help with the selection process and transition to assisted living.

Finding Affordable Assisted Living in Silver City, Nevada

Finding affordable assisted living for a loved one can feel overwhelming, especially in a smaller community like Silver City. The desire to find a safe, supportive environment that respects your budget is a common and understandable concern. The good news is that with careful planning and a clear understanding of the options available, finding a suitable and affordable solution is entirely possible.

First, it’s helpful to define what “affordable” means in the context of Silver City and the surrounding region. While our town offers a tight-knit community and a quieter pace of life, families often look to nearby Carson City or the Carson Valley for a broader range of assisted living facilities. This proximity can be an advantage, allowing for more choices while still maintaining a connection to the familiar high desert landscape and climate that many seniors cherish. When evaluating affordability, look beyond just the monthly rent. Understand exactly what is included in the base fee—such as meals, housekeeping, utilities, and a certain number of assistance hours with daily activities. A seemingly higher monthly rate that includes comprehensive care can sometimes be more cost-effective than a lower base rate with numerous add-on fees.

Exploring financial assistance programs is a crucial step. Nevada offers several resources that can help bridge the gap. The Medicaid Waiver program, often called the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) waiver, can provide significant financial support for assisted living services for those who qualify. It’s important to start this application process early, as there can be waiting lists. Additionally, veterans and their spouses should absolutely investigate Aid and Attendance benefits through the VA, which can provide a monthly pension to help cover the costs of care. Local Area Agencies on Aging, such as the Nevada Aging and Disability Services Division, are invaluable free resources for navigating these complex programs.

Another practical strategy is to consider shared living arrangements. Some assisted living communities in the region offer shared apartments or roommate-matching services, which can dramatically reduce the monthly cost for each resident. This setup can also provide built-in companionship, which is a wonderful benefit for social and emotional well-being. Don’t overlook the potential of smaller, residential care homes. Silver City’s character is defined by its residential feel, and there are often licensed care homes in nearby areas that provide assisted living to just a few residents in a family-style setting. These can sometimes offer more competitive pricing and highly personalized care than larger facilities.

Finally, have open and honest conversations with facility administrators. When you tour a community, be upfront about your budget constraints. Ask if they offer any financial scholarships, sliding scale fees based on income, or if they have any plans to participate in new state-funded programs. Remember, affordability must be balanced with quality of life. In our climate, consider amenities like accessible outdoor spaces for enjoying the sunny days and safe, warm interiors for the cooler desert nights. Finding the right place means finding a balance where your loved one feels comfortable, engaged, and cared for, without placing an unsustainable financial burden on the family. Taking it one step at a time, utilizing local resources, and asking detailed questions will guide you toward a solution that brings peace of mind.
